Output 66bc889042a19e37fd6a91451e79183945879f7e32bea75afc2e3b7b21be366a:0

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677521d57ac96197750baae646fe209221f45c2d OP_EQUAL
address
3B83qne4tfb9Xgy692P3yGA9M49UsT3cLk
transaction
66bc889042a19e37fd6a91451e79183945879f7e32bea75afc2e3b7b21be366a
spent
true